Cannot find grldr in all drives
|
|
MuKeP | Дата: Понедельник, 13.01.2014, 13:40 | Сообщение # 1 |
Неизвестный
Группа: Пользователи
Сообщений: 2
Статус: Отсутствует
| Доброе время суток.
Собственно сабж появляется не на всех компьютерах, с которых пытаюсь загрузиться. А скорее на большинстве не появляется. Компьютеры сравнительно старые, но загрузку с USB поддерживают (о чем говорит сама попытка загрузиться с (hd0).
Поставил Grub4Dos при помощи WinSetupFromUSB 1.2 на USB Flash (8Gb) файловая система FAT32.
груб ставил 0.4.5с ввиду того, что когда я ставил 0.4.6а загрузка уходила в цикл поиска загрузчика (на всех компьютерах).
загрузчик не переименовывал и не перемещал. лежит он в корне флешки.
Если кто сталкивался с сабжем при моих условиях или знает как это пофиксить буду очень благодарен.
|
|
| |
Atlant | Дата: Понедельник, 13.01.2014, 14:21 | Сообщение # 2 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| Пробуй на проблемных ПК: 1) BootIce (выбрать флешку) > Parts manage > Activate (нажать если возможно). 2) BootIce > Process MBR > Windows NT 5.x/6.x > Install > Windows NT 6.x > OK. 3) BootIce > Process PBR > Grub4Dos > Install > Version 0.4.5c > OK > OK.
|
|
| |
MuKeP | Дата: Понедельник, 13.01.2014, 17:10 | Сообщение # 3 |
Неизвестный
Группа: Пользователи
Сообщений: 2
Статус: Отсутствует
| Проблема разрешилась довольно непонятным образом. Требует перепроверки.
Но суть такова: Используя RMPrepUSB я отформатировал с boot сектором SYSLINUX с опцией Boot as HDD
потом с WinSetupFromUSB установил SysLinux bootsector/Linux ...
он прописался в MBR, поскидывал свои файлы в корень флешки. оказалось, что в MBR записан grub4dos. в PBR syslinux, в корне лежит menu.lst.
перед тем, как переформатирвоать флешку я все ее содержимое сохранил + бэкап mbr, pbr.
скинул все содержимое после вышеупомянутых манипуляций в корень флешки, заменил menu.lst
и ЧСХ все заработало.
но приду домой - переделаю все заново, чтобы не было косяков и непонятков.
Возможность этого я понял после того как другую флешку сделал с помощью yumi. Поставил на флешку memtest. после загрузки флешка сама определилась в биосе. я посмотрел, что в pbr - syslinux. думал, что поставлю grub2, в котором пропишу загрузку grub4dos. Но этого не понадобилось, ввиду либо особенностей WinSetupFromUSB или же RMPrepUSB.
По моему крайне скромному мнению достаточно было отформатировать флешку в RMPrepUSB с любым загрузочным сектором НО с опцией Boot as HDD.
Когда флешка воспринимается как HDD то все должно происходить нормально. все проблемы из-за большого радиуса кривизны моих рук.
Сообщение отредактировал MuKeP - Понедельник, 13.01.2014, 17:18 |
|
| |
Atlant | Дата: Понедельник, 13.01.2014, 17:18 | Сообщение # 4 |
Эксперт
Группа: Проверенные
Сообщений: 2210
Статус: Отсутствует
| MBR от Grub4Dos-а сразу ищет и запускает файл (grldr), в обход PBR. WinSetupFromUSB ставит MBR - Grub4Dos, PBR не трогает. Но MBR - Grub4Dos большой и на некоторых материнках виснет (еще на этапе обнаружения биосом запоминающих устройств), а с MBR от семерки таких проблем нет (Windows NT 6.x).
|
|
| |